Classification:
Juncus arcticus Willd. ssp. littoralis (Engelm.) Hultén

Click on a scientific name below to expand it in the PLANTS Classification Report.
   
Kingdom Plantae – Plants
Subkingdom Tracheobionta – Vascular plants
Superdivision Spermatophyta – Seed plants
Division Magnoliophyta – Flowering plants
Class Liliopsida – Monocotyledons
Subclass Commelinidae
Order Juncales
Family Juncaceae – Rush family
Genus Juncus L. – rush
Species Juncus arcticus Willd. – arctic rush
Subspecies Juncus arcticus Willd. ssp. littoralis (Engelm.) Hultén – mountain rush
 

Threatened and Endangered Information:
Juncus arcticus Willd. ssp. littoralis (Engelm.) Hultén

The synonym italicized and indented below is listed by the U.S. federal government or a state. Common names are from state and federal lists. Click on a place name to get a complete protected plant list for that location.

Indiana:
Juncus balticus var. littoralis
Baltic rush              Rare
Maryland:
Juncus balticus
Baltic rush              Endangered, Extirpated
Pennsylvania:
Juncus balticus
Baltic rush              Threatened
